San Antonio blends rich history, military heritage, and affordable senior living into a compelling package. The city boasts numerous VA facilities plus Methodist and Baptist health systems, serving many retired military families. Communities near the River Walk, Alamo Heights, and Stone Oak provide diverse options, while lower living costs compared to Dallas or Houston stretch retirement income. San Antonio's Hispanic culture, mild winters, and family-oriented atmosphere create a warm, welcoming environment for aging adults and caregivers.

Start by touring at least 3-5 communities to compare. Check state licensing and inspection reports. Ask about staff-to-resident ratios, activities, dining options, and what services are included vs. extra charges. Talk to current residents and families about their experiences.
